The Breakdown 12

  • Chicago Cubs center fielder Pete Crow-Armstrong faced backlash after a heated and vulgar exchange with a female White Sox fan during a game on May 17, 2026, leading to a stunning defeat for his team.
  • In the wake of the incident, Crow-Armstrong candidly expressed his regret, stating that he does not take pride in his choice of words and recognizing that he lost control of the situation.
  • The Cubs' manager, Craig Counsell, supported Crow-Armstrong's acknowledgment of his mistake, highlighting the emotional toll that fan interactions can impose on players.

What led to Crow-Armstrong's heated exchange?

Pete Crow-Armstrong's heated exchange with a White Sox fan occurred during a tense moment in a City Series game on May 17, 2026. The Cubs were in a tight match, ultimately losing 9-8, and emotions ran high. Crow-Armstrong's frustration likely stemmed from the game's pressure and the fan's comments, which he later described as harassing. This incident gained significant media attention, highlighting the challenges athletes face in managing their emotions in competitive environments.

What historical incidents involve player-fan conflicts?

Historical incidents of player-fan conflicts abound in sports, with notable examples including the infamous 'Malice at the Palace' in basketball, where players clashed with fans. Baseball has its share as well, such as when fans threw objects at players or when players retaliated verbally or physically. These incidents highlight the volatile nature of fan interactions and the potential for escalation, emphasizing the need for both players and fans to exercise restraint.
